12 Best Foods High in Niacin

Vitamin B3 is another name for niacin. It is a micronutrient that the human body uses for antioxidant production, proper metabolism, and nervous system function. A human body is unable to produce niacin on its own. You have to consume different food items.

What Is Niacin?

Niacin generally goes by multiple names: niacinamide, vitamin B3, nicotinamide, nicotinic acid, etc. It is soluble in water. Animal proteins contain a higher amount of niacin than any plant-based food. Niacin can help to maintain your health and prevent your body from developing several health hazards.

The recommended dietary allowance or RAD for niacin is around 14 mg and 16 mg daily for women and men, respectively. Here is a list of top food items which are high in niacin.

1. Chicken breast

Chicken breast is an excellent source of lean protein and niacin. 11.4 mg of niacin is present in 85 grams of skinless, boneless, and boiled chicken breast. However, the same amount of chicken thigh has only half the amount of niacin.

An excellent option for a high-protein, low-calorie diet is chicken breast. It works wonders for maintaining a healthy lifestyle and losing weight.

2. Liver

85 grams of cooked beef liver contains around 14.7 mg of niacin. That is approximately 100% of the RDA and 91% of the RDA for women and men, respectively. 85 grams of chicken liver can provide 83% of the RDA and 73% of the RDA for women and men, respectively. Chicken or beef liver contains iron, vitamin A, protein, choline, and other B vitamins. 

3. Tuna

Tuna is a great source of niacin, especially for people who prefer eating fish. For example, 165 grams of tuna fish can offer 21.9 mg of niacin. In addition, tuna contains protein, vitamins B12 and B6, omega-3 fatty acids, and selenium.

4. Salmon

The niacin content in salmon is always high. One cooked salmon of 85 grams provides 61% of the RDA and 53% of the RDA for women and men, respectively. Atlantic salmons contain lesser niacin than wild-caught salmons.

As a result, they are a great source of omega-3 fatty acids. Omega-3 can reduce the risk of developing inflammatory diseases, heart problems, or autoimmune disorders.

5. Turkey

Turkeys contain slightly less niacin than chickens. However, they provide another element called tryptophan, which can transform into niacin in your body. For example, 85 grams of turkey breast can provide around 6.3 mg of niacin.

Tryptophan can produce around one milligram of niacin in your body. Together, it is about 52% of the RDA and 46% of the RDA for women and men, respectively.

Tryptophan can produce melatonin hormone and the neurotransmitter called serotonin. Both of them are useful for your sleep and the condition of your mood.

6. Pork

Lean pork chops or pork tenderloin are excellent sources of niacin. For example, 85 grams of roasted pork tenderloin can provide around 6.3 mg of niacin. That is about 45% and 39% of the RDA for women and men, respectively.

On the other hand, roasted pork shoulders of similar weight can offer only 24% and 20% of the RDA for women and men, respectively. This is because pork also contains vitamin B1, which plays a significant role in the metabolism process of your body.

7. Anchovies

Canned anchovies can be considered inexpensive to fulfill the need for niacin. One anchovy offers around 5% of the RDA for adult women and men. They are also a great source of selenium. Each anchovy contains approximately 4% of the RDI. Selenium can 22% reduce the risk of getting cancer. It works best for breast, lung, prostate, stomach, and esophagus cancer.

8. Peanuts

Peanuts are one of the best vegetarian sources of niacin. 32 grams of peanut butter can offer 4.3 mg of niacin. It is around 25% of the RDA and 30% of the RDA for men and women, respectively. Peanuts are rich sources of vitamin E, protein, monounsaturated fats, vitamin B6, phosphorus, manganese, and magnesium.

Daily consumption of peanuts can lower the risk of type 2 diabetes. However, it does not play any role in weight gain.

9. Ground Beef

Ground beef is an excellent source of iron, vitamin B12 protein, zinc, and selenium. In addition, 85 grams of cooked 95% lean ground beef contain 6.2 mg of niacin. However, the same amount of 70% lean ground beef can provide 4.1 mg of niacin.

10. Brown Rice

195 grams of cooked brown rice can provide 18% and 21% of the RDA for men and women, respectively. According to the experts, 30% of niacin in grains can be available for absorption. Brown rice is also a great source of fiber, vitamin B6, thiamin, phosphorus, magnesium, selenium, and manganese. Brown rice can reduce inflammation and improve heart conditions in obese women.

11. Avocado

One medium-sized avocado can offer 3.5 mg of niacin, that’s 25% and 21% of RDA in women and men, respectively. Avocado is also a great source of healthy fats, fiber, multiple minerals, and vitamins. In addition, regular consumption of avocados can reduce the risk of developing any heart disease.

12. Mushrooms

Niacin is present in about 2.5 mg per 70 grams of mushrooms. That is 18% and 15% of the RDA for women and men, respectively. So this is a fantastic way for vegans and vegetarians to meet their bodies’ needs for niacin.

5 Health Benefits of Niacin

#1. Niacin can prevent the breakdown of fats into any individual components to lower the level of triglycerides and fats in your body. However, you must consult your doctor before consuming niacin in high amounts. Overconsumption niacin can cause several side effects like rashes, headaches, nausea, etc.

#2. Niacin can also help to decrease insulin sensitivity.

#3. Regular consumption of niacin can reduce the chances of developing cancer.

#4. A high dosage of niacin can also rapidly recover HIV patients.

#5. Niacin deficiency can cause conditions like diarrhea, dementia, dermatitis, and even death in certain conditions.


Vitamin B3, or niacin, is an essential nutrient that you must include in your diet. It has multiple benefits for your body. But most importantly, it can help metabolism and improve your nervous system.

